In this episode Lisa engages in a deep conversation with Nicole Cherie Hesse about her journey of self-discovery, the writing of her fiction novel 'A Shadow Called Sunshine', and the themes of self-worth and advocacy against domestic violence. Nicole shares her transformative experiences that inspired her writing, the challenges of vulnerability in storytelling, and the importance of creating narratives that empower individuals to reclaim their worth. The discussion emphasizes the significance of personal growth, emotional healing, and the impact of storytelling in advocating for change.
